The third term of the geometric progression will be 1 / 27 with common ratio 2 / 3.
We are given that:
2nd term of geometric progression = 1 / 18
5th term = 4 / 243
Now, we can also write it as:
2nd term = a r ( where r is the common ratio and a is the initial term.)
a r = 1 / 18
5th term = a r⁴
a r⁴ = 4 / 243
Now divide 5th term by 2nd term, we get that:
a r⁴ / a r = ( 4 / 243 ) / ( 1 / 18 )
r³ = 72 / 243
r³ = 8 / 27
r = ∛ (8 / 27)
r = 2 / 3
3rd term = a r²
a r² = a r × r
= 1 / 18 × 2 / 3
3rd term = 1 / 27
Therefore, the third term of the geometric progression will be 1 / 27 with common ratio 2 / 3.

Note that
a² - b² = (a+b)(a-b)
i² = -1 by definition.
We want to factorize x² + 36 = x² + 6².
Consider the expression
x² - (6i)² = x² - (6²)(i²) = x² - 36i² = x² + 36
Because x² - (6i)² = (x + 6i)(x - 6i)
Therefore
x² + 36 = (x + 6i)(x - 6i)
Answer: (x + 6i)(x - 6i)
